Are Battery Operated Toothbrushes Any Good?

The question of whether a battery-operated toothbrush is beneficial over a manual one is common for those seeking an upgrade to their oral hygiene routine. These devices, often called “power toothbrushes,” occupy a middle ground between traditional manual brushing and high-end rechargeable electric models. Understanding the mechanics and performance of these battery-powered options is the first step in assessing their role in effective plaque removal and gum health.

Distinguishing Battery-Powered from Rechargeable Electric

Battery-powered toothbrushes, which typically rely on disposable AA or AAA batteries, are mechanically distinct from their rechargeable counterparts. These models usually feature a basic motor that provides a gentle vibration or a low-frequency oscillating motion to the brush head, offering a slight boost to manual effort. The user is still responsible for performing most of the manual brushing motion and technique to effectively clean all surfaces of the teeth.

Rechargeable electric toothbrushes, in contrast, utilize built-in lithium-ion batteries and a dedicated charging base, delivering a significantly higher frequency of movement. These models employ advanced technologies like high-speed sonic vibrations or rapid rotation-oscillation, which provide the bulk of the cleaning action. This higher power allows the user to simply guide the brush head over the teeth.

Performance Comparison Against Manual Brushing

Dental research indicates that battery-operated brushes offer a measurable, though modest, advantage in cleaning performance over standard manual brushing. The vibrating or low-speed oscillating action provides additional mechanical scrubbing that a manual brush cannot replicate alone. Studies have shown that some battery-powered models can remove a statistically significant amount of plaque compared to a manual toothbrush, with research finding an improvement of around 9.5% in plaque removal after a few weeks of use.

This improvement is often attributed to the brush’s ability to reduce the reliance on perfect user technique, as the powered motion assists in disrupting plaque. For gingival health, these brushes have also been shown to reduce existing gingivitis, with reductions ranging from 8% to 40% in studies lasting a month or more. However, the cleaning power and plaque reduction achieved by these disposable battery models are generally less pronounced than those produced by high-frequency, dedicated rechargeable electric toothbrushes.

Practical Considerations for Daily Use

The primary appeal of battery-operated toothbrushes lies in their low barrier to entry and convenience for certain lifestyles. Their initial cost is often only slightly higher than a manual toothbrush, making them an affordable introduction to powered cleaning. Since they do not require a charging base, they are naturally lightweight and highly portable, making them ideal for travel or use in shared bathrooms without counter space.

The trade-off for this convenience is the need for more frequent maintenance, specifically the replacement of AA or AAA batteries, which can be an ongoing cost and source of waste. Furthermore, battery-powered models typically lack the advanced features common in premium rechargeable brushes, such as pressure sensors to prevent hard brushing or built-in quadrant timers to ensure a full two minutes of cleaning. These simple power brushes serve well as a budget-conscious upgrade or a reliable travel companion.
